Tarentum, Calabria
Silver nomos, 21 mm, 7.76 gm. Obv: Nude helmeted warrior on horseback left, with shield and javelin. Rev: Phalanthos, holding helmet, astride dolphin left, TARAS below. Minted in Calabria, 333-330 BC. Tarentum (Taras) was founded in 706 BC by Dorian immigrants from Sparta. It became a commercial power and a sovereign city of Magna Graecia, ruling over the Greek colonies in southern Italy. Acquired from Edward J. Waddell, Ltd., 1989.
